2013-03-22 194 views
0

我是web服务和WSDL的新手。我正在使用WSO2创建我的第一个Web服务。 对于这个问题,我使用了与WSO2二进制版本一起提供的Calculator.wsdl。无法找到或加载主类org.apache.axis2.wsdl.WSDL2CPP

我执行以下命令来生成服务骨架: WSDL2CPP.bat -uri Calculator.wsdl -ss -sd -d adb -u(带轴数据绑定) 和 WSDL2CPP.bat -uri Calculator.wsdl -ss -sd -d none(无数据绑定),

我输出为: 找不到或加载主类的有机.apache.axis2.wsdl.WSDL2CPP

我在Windows上使用WSO2版本2.1.0。 我已经添加了PATH变量以及 D:\ wso2-wsf-cpp-bin-2.1.0-win32 \ lib; D:\ wso2-wsf-cpp-bin-2.1.0-win32 \ bin \ tools \ codegen \ wsdl2cpp;

我知道这是非常基本的问题,但我坚持了第一步。

你可以在这方面提出任何指示。 在此先感谢

+0

我被困在这。任何人都可以分享一些想法吗? – theone 2013-03-25 05:32:50

回答

0

更具体地说(除了戈库尔的答案),你需要经过安装Maven,下载的代码生成工具和构建它的过程。在Gokul给出的链接中对此进行了非常简短的介绍。

我不认为你的问题是环境变量,而是你没有经历构建codegen工具的过程。

相关问题